Item 5.02 | Departure of Directors or Certain Officers; Election of Directors; Appointment of Certain Officers; Compensatory Arrangements of Certain Officers. |
On August 9, 2018, Dorman Products, Inc. (the “Company”) announced that Mathias J. Barton will be retiring as President and Chief Executive Officer (“CEO”) of the Company. On August 6, 2018, the Board of Directors (the “Board”) approved a succession plan and appointed Kevin M. Olsen, the Company’s Executive Vice President and Chief Financial Officer (“CFO”), as the Company’s President and Chief Operating Officer effective as of August 6, 2018 and as the Company’s President and CEO effective as of January 1, 2019. Mr. Barton stepped down as President of the Company effective as of August 6, 2018 and will remain CEO of the Company until his retirement on December 31, 2018. In connection with assuming his new position, Mr. Olsen stepped down as CFO, principal financial officer and principal accounting officer of the Company and the Board appointed Michael P. Ginnetti, the Company’s Corporate Controller, as the Company’s interim CFO, interim principal financial officer and interim principal accounting officer effective as of August 6, 2018. Mr. Ginnetti will serve in such positions until a successor is named. The Company is conducting an executive search for a permanent CFO.
Mr. Olsen, 47, joined the Company in June 2016 as Senior Vice President and CFO. He became Executive Vice President and CFO in June 2017. Prior to joining the Company, Mr. Olsen was Chief Financial Officer of Colfax Fluid Handling, a division of Colfax Corporation, a diversified global manufacturing and engineering company that provides gas and fluid-handling and fabrication technology products and services to commercial and governmental customers around the world, from January 2013 through June 2016. Prior to joining Colfax, he served in progressively responsible management roles at the Forged Products Aero Turbine Division of Precision Castparts Corp, Crane Energy Flow Solutions, a division of Crane Co., Netshape Technologies, Inc., and Danaher Corporation. Prior thereto, Mr. Olsen performed public accounting work at PwC, LLP.
Mr. Ginnetti, 41, currently serves as Vice President, Corporate Controller of the Company. He has served in this position since May 2011 and he will continue to serve in this position while serving as interim CFO. Mr. Ginnetti previously served as the Company’s interim CFO for the period February 27, 2016 through June 12, 2016. Prior to joining the Company, Mr. Ginnetti was employed by Technitrol, Inc., an electronic components manufacturer, from 2001 to 2011, most recently as Corporate Controller and Chief Accounting Officer. Previously, he was employed by Arthur Andersen LLP in the Audit and Business Advisory practice.
